Project

KU Leuven is seeking a highly motivated PhD student to work on robot learning for vision-driven manipulation. The project focuses on using multi-modal foundation models to facilitate the acquisition of manipulation skills. Initially, the agent will passively observe tasks commanded via tele-operation, then gradually learn to mimic the behavior of the operator, eventually achieving autonomous operation. Specific objectives will be established jointly with the successful candidate.

Profile

The successful candidate must:

- Hold a degree(s) in engineering, physics, math, computer science, or a related field, with a strong background in machine learning and/or computer vision, acquired either through coursework or self-study,

- Demonstrate research experience (e.g., through Master's thesis or research internship),

- Demonstrate the ability to assist with TA work, either with a degree in EE or ME, or with transcripts of courses relevant to EE or ME.

Offer

KU Leuven is Belgium's largest university and a leading higher education and research institution, ranked among the top 100 universities worldwide. The offer includes:
- A four-year fully funded PhD position at one of Europe's top universities,
- A competitive salary or tax-free scholarship,
- State-provided health insurance,
- A thorough scientific education within a specialized doctoral training program,
- The opportunity to participate in international conferences and workshops,
- Working with two thriving research teams: group PSI (Electrical Engineering) and group RAM (Mechanical Engineering),
- Working in Leuven, a charming city located a short 20-min train ride from Brussels.
Responsibilities
- Carry out research on the project specified above and publish findings in top-tier robotics, computer-vision and machine-learning journals and conferences,
- Assist in the supervision of Master's thesis students,
- Perform a limited amount of teaching activities (on average three hours per week).
